Ingredients Explained
The secret to the perfect Beet Smoothie Recipe is using fresh, wholesome ingredients that work together to create a creamy texture, naturally sweet flavor, and a boost of nutrition. Here’s why each ingredient matters.
🥕 Fresh Beetroot

Fresh beetroot is the star ingredient of this smoothie. It adds a beautiful deep-red color, a mildly earthy sweetness, and is naturally rich in fiber, folate, potassium, vitamin C, and antioxidants. For the smoothest texture, peel and chop the beet into small pieces before blending.
🍌 Banana

A ripe banana naturally sweetens the smoothie while creating a thick and creamy consistency. It also provides potassium and vitamin B6, making this smoothie more filling and satisfying.
🫐 Mixed Berries

Frozen mixed berries add natural sweetness, vibrant flavor, and extra antioxidants. They also help balance the earthy taste of beetroot while giving the smoothie a refreshing, fruity finish.
🥛 Greek Yogurt

Greek yogurt makes the smoothie rich, creamy, and protein-packed. It also adds probiotics that support gut health and helps keep you full for longer.
🥥 Almond Milk

Unsweetened almond milk creates a light, silky texture without adding unnecessary sugar. You can also substitute oat milk, dairy milk, or coconut milk based on your preference.
🌰 Chia Seeds (Optional)

Chia seeds are a simple way to increase the fiber, omega-3 fatty acids, and protein content of your smoothie. They also help create a thicker texture after blending.
🍯 Honey or Maple Syrup (Optional)

If your beetroot isn’t naturally sweet enough, a small drizzle of honey or pure maple syrup adds just the right amount of sweetness without overpowering the fresh ingredients.
🧊 Ice Cubes

Ice cubes make the smoothie refreshingly cold and slightly thicker, giving it a delicious café-style texture that’s perfect for warm mornings or post-workout recovery.
💡 Pro Tip
For the best Beet Smoothie Recipe, use cooked or steamed beetroot if you prefer a milder flavor and an extra-smooth texture. If using raw beetroot, chop it into small pieces and blend it in a high-speed blender for the creamiest results.

Detailed Instructions
Step 1: Prepare the Ingredients

Wash the fresh beetroot thoroughly under running water to remove any dirt. Peel the beetroot using a vegetable peeler, then cut it into small cubes to help it blend more easily. Peel the ripe banana and gather the remaining ingredients, including the mixed berries, Greek yogurt, almond milk, chia seeds (if using), honey or maple syrup, and ice cubes.
💡 Tip: If you’re using raw beetroot, cutting it into smaller pieces will help create a smoother texture and reduce the strain on your blender.
Step 2: Add the Liquid Ingredients

Pour the unsweetened almond milk into the blender first, followed by the Greek yogurt. Adding the liquid ingredients before the solid ingredients helps the blender create a smooth vortex, making it easier to blend everything evenly without overworking the motor.
💡 Tip: For a dairy-free version, replace Greek yogurt with a plant-based yogurt and use your favorite non-dairy milk.
Step 3: Add the Remaining Ingredients

Add the chopped beetroot, banana, mixed berries, chia seeds (if using), honey or maple syrup (if desired), and ice cubes to the blender. Layering the ingredients this way helps the blades pull everything down for faster and more even blending.
💡 Tip: Frozen berries not only add natural sweetness but also make the smoothie thicker and refreshingly cold.
Step 4: Blend Until Smooth

Blend everything on high speed for 45–60 seconds, or until the smoothie becomes completely smooth and creamy. Stop the blender and scrape down the sides if needed, then blend for another 10–15 seconds.
💡 Tip: If the smoothie is too thick, add a splash of almond milk. If it’s too thin, add a few more frozen berries or a little extra banana.
Step 5: Taste and Adjust

Taste the smoothie before serving. If you’d like it sweeter, add a small drizzle of honey or pure maple syrup and blend again for a few seconds. If you prefer a colder smoothie, add a few extra ice cubes and blend briefly.
💡 Tip: The sweetness of the smoothie depends on how ripe your banana and berries are, so adjust only after tasting.
Step 6: Serve and Enjoy

Pour the Beet Smoothie Recipe into chilled glasses or wide-mouth mason jars. Garnish with a sprinkle of chia seeds, fresh berries, or a small mint sprig for an attractive presentation. Serve immediately to enjoy the freshest flavor, creamy texture, and maximum nutritional value.
💡 Tip: This smoothie tastes best when enjoyed right after blending, as the texture and vibrant color are at their peak.
Health Benefits of This Beet Smoothie
This Beet Smoothie Recipe is more than just a colorful and refreshing drink—it’s packed with wholesome ingredients that provide a variety of nutrients to support a balanced diet and healthy lifestyle.
❤️ 1. Supports Heart Health
Beetroot contains naturally occurring dietary nitrates that may help support healthy blood flow and normal blood pressure as part of a balanced diet. Potassium from bananas also contributes to normal heart function.
⚡ 2. Provides Natural Energy
The combination of beetroot, banana, and berries supplies natural carbohydrates that can help fuel your body before exercise or replenish energy afterward, making this smoothie a great pre- or post-workout option.
🛡️ 3. Rich in Antioxidants
Beetroot and mixed berries are excellent sources of antioxidants, including betalains and anthocyanins. These compounds help protect cells from oxidative stress and support overall wellness.
🌿 4. Promotes Healthy Digestion
Fresh beetroot, banana, berries, and chia seeds provide dietary fiber, which supports healthy digestion, promotes regular bowel movements, and helps keep you feeling full longer.
💪 5. Good Source of Protein
Greek yogurt adds high-quality protein, helping support muscle maintenance and making this Beet Smoothie Recipe more satisfying as a breakfast or snack.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Is this Beet Smoothie Recipe healthy?
Yes! This Beet Smoothie Recipe is made with nutrient-rich ingredients like fresh beetroot, banana, mixed berries, Greek yogurt, and almond milk. It’s a good source of fiber, antioxidants, vitamins, and protein, making it a wholesome choice for breakfast or a healthy snack.
2. Can I use raw beetroot in this Beet Smoothie Recipe?
Absolutely. You can use raw beetroot, but be sure to peel it and chop it into small pieces before blending. If you prefer a milder flavor and an even creamier texture, you can also use cooked or steamed beetroot.
3. Can I make this Beet Smoothie Recipe without Greek yogurt?
Yes. You can replace Greek yogurt with dairy-free yogurt, coconut yogurt, or simply add a little more almond milk. The smoothie will still be creamy and delicious.
4. Can I prepare this Beet Smoothie Recipe ahead of time?
Yes, but it’s best enjoyed immediately after blending for the freshest flavor and texture. If needed, store it in an airtight mason jar or container in the refrigerator for up to 24 hours and shake well before serving.
5. Can I customize this Beet Smoothie Recipe?
Definitely! You can add spinach, oats, flaxseeds, protein powder, peanut butter, or chia seeds to boost nutrition and customize the flavor. Frozen berries or frozen banana also make the smoothie thicker and creamier.
